U¼ϲ presidential search advisory committee announced

The ¼ϲ Board of Regents announced today the formation of an advisory committee in its search for the 23rd University of ¼ϲ president.

The U¼ϲ Presidential Search Advisory Committee – appointed by ¼ϲ Chair Cecilia Mata – includes 18 members comprised of regents and campus community members. The committee will serve as advisors to ¼ϲ as it searches for and decides on the next president.

“When selecting this committee, I wanted to make sure its members would bring diverse perspectives and a wide array of expertise. Their leadership, insights and contributions will be instrumental to the success of this search process,” said Chair Mata. “As the board embarks on selecting the next president of the University of ¼ϲ, we will do so thoughtfully and with community input to ensure we find a visionary leader who can make a lasting impact on this top-tier research university.”

The advisory committee has one of the largest contingencies of faculty on an ¼ϲ presidential search advisory committee and represents a broad array of campus organizations and leadership roles. Members’ experience includes knowledge of topics central to the university’s continued success such as students’ educational experiences, faculty and alumni relations, financial acumen and the university’s place in the community.

The committee’s first meeting will take place Wednesday at 2:30 p.m. in Tucson.

U¼ϲ President Robert Robbins announced in April he will step down as president after fulfilling the terms of his current contract. President Robert Robbins will continue to lead the university until his successor is ready to begin her or his tenure.
